Originally Published as BX essentials, Old School essentials is a remake of Basic/Expert Dungeons and Dragons sets (Hereafter referred to as BX D&D). It prizes itself on fidelity and clarity of organization. It even has a whole appendix dedicated just to what changes they made from the original in order to make things clearer or more usable.

Honestly It's a pretty straightforward pitch. Also, it has some very nice art.
